Your Role

The Engineering Practice Leader will serve a lead function in:

  • Leading project/program and business development activities;
  • Proposal and budget development;
  • Strategic planning;
  • Building relationships with existing and potential clients, as well as managing client interaction;
  • Providing high level consultation to clients;
  • Managing staff, provide staff training and project leadership; and
  • Managing geotechnical and construction inspection projects.

Geotechnical engineering, including:
  • Coordination and supervising SPT boring and rock core drilling;
  • Subsurface evaluations and preparation of geotechnical subsurface investigation reports;
  • Foundation evaluation (e.g., foundation types, bearing capacities, settlement analyses, etc.);
  • Slope stability evaluation, flexible and rigid pavements;
  • Construction inspection and testing (soil, concrete, masonry, structural steel, spray applied fire proofing, etc.);
  • Preparation of field reports, geotechnical field consulting, and evaluation of adverse earthwork conditions;
  • Management of geotechnical laboratory and able to conduct laboratory testing; and
  • Periodic travel to project sites for meetings, audits, or other activities.

Civil and environmental engineering including:
  • Oversight of projects and staff supporting hazardous waste site investigation/remedial engineering;
  • Water line extension and water/ground treatment treatment system design engineering, construction, and operation.

The candidate will also interface with other Environmental and Community Planning/Economic Development Practice Leaders to cross-sell services and enhance customer experience.

Qualifications

15 or more years of relevant experience, including proven experience in special inspections, geotechnical engineering, and materials testing, with a track record of successful project delivery.

Successful demonstration of subject matter expertise and technical leadership, and teamwork skills to support project pursuits and implementation of projects with existing and new clients.

Construction experience and ability to trouble shoot issues in the field.

Knowledge of relevant industry-specific software and tools.

Ability to read, analyze, and interpret complex documents. Demonstrated problem-solving abilities and attention to detail.

Must able to read and speak English fluently, with outstanding oral and written communication skills.

A strong commitment to safety and quality.

This position requires driving on a regular basis. Passing a motor vehicle record background check and maintaining a valid driver's license and good driving record is required.

Degree / Certifications

BS in Civil Engineering or Geological Engineering with an emphasis in geotechnical applications is required.

MS in Geotechnical Engineering preferred, plus equivalent experience.

Registered as a Professional Engineer in Delaware, Maryland, and Pennsylvania.
